The brief

Amperiza is a family real estate business in Alcúdia that manages its portfolio and commercial follow up in Inmovilla. The agency needed a website of its own that presented that portfolio properly, without asking the team to maintain a second catalogue.

Visit the live site

What it had to solve

  • 01The portfolio had to stay in Inmovilla, where the team already works every day.
  • 02Buyers arrive with different intentions, browsing an area, chasing a single reference, or weighing up several homes at once.
  • 03Owners considering a sale needed a route that was not the same form as a property enquiry.
  • 04The agency sells to both local and international buyers, so the site had to work in two languages without duplicating the catalogue.

How it was carried out

The phases the project moved through, in order.

  1. 01

    Portfolio and connection

    Reviewed what the Inmovilla account could share and how often changes needed to appear, then agreed the connection. The website checks each update and keeps the last valid catalogue rather than emptying the site if an update arrives incomplete.

  2. 02

    Search built on the real catalogue

    Filters were drawn from the properties the agency actually sells, covering operation, price, property type, bedrooms, surface and features, with area, reference and keyword search, and a switch between list and map.

  3. 03

    Property pages and favourites

    Each record carries gallery, price, reference, location, surfaces, rooms, features and energy information, with a contact route tied to that property. Visitors can save homes and come back to their selection without creating an account.

  4. 04

    Four enquiry routes

    Property enquiry, general contact, initial valuation request, and owners wanting to sell were separated, so each one reaches the team with the details needed to answer it.

  5. 05

    Two languages with editorial control

    Spanish and English across the portfolio and public pages, with the English version reviewable by the agency without touching the source content held in Inmovilla.

  6. 06

    Agency panel

    A panel limited to website controls. The agency can view the received catalogue without editing CRM data, choose and order featured properties, review the English presentation, read website enquiries, and see whether an update or a delivery needs attention.

  7. 07

    Testing and launch

    Listings added, changed and withdrawn were checked end to end, along with forms from phone and desktop, enquiry delivery with reference and context, spam protection, and measurement that only activates after consent.

How it was built

Next.js and React
Pages are rendered before they reach the visitor rather than assembled in the browser afterwards.
PostgreSQL
Holds the received catalogue so that area, price and map searches answer from one prepared set of properties.
Inmovilla connection
The catalogue stays in the CRM. The website keeps the last valid version if an update arrives incomplete.
Spanish and English
Both versions run from the same catalogue, with the English presentation reviewable by the agency.
Consent based measurement
Nothing is measured until a visitor agrees to it.

Measured performance

The delivered website was measured with PageSpeed Insights on desktop and mobile. These are Lighthouse lab results from a simulated environment on the date shown, not field data from real visitors.

Lighthouse lab results for the Amperiza homepage, captured on 21 August 2026
MeasureDesktopMobile
Performance score9671
SEO score100100
First Contentful Paint (FCP)0.7 s2.9 s
Largest Contentful Paint (LCP)1.3 s6.0 s
Total Blocking Time (TBT)10 ms10 ms
Cumulative Layout Shift (CLS)00
Speed Index (SI)1.3 s4.6 s

Lab results vary between runs as network conditions, processing and page resources change. A capture describes that run, not a fixed property of the website.

They do not predict search positions, enquiry volume or any other business outcome.

The mobile run recorded its content later than the desktop run, while blocking time and layout shift stayed level across both devices.
